Those changes to RS laws for LL taking units for his or family use are recent changes that came in 2019.
Prior to 2019 law wasn't exactly so precise and you had LL's of say a brownstone or townhouse seeking to get four, five or more apartments out of RS. Most owners stated they wanted to turn a property that once was a single family home but subsequently chopped up into apartments back again.
What happened often enough is after RS tenant was gotten rid of said apartment never was occupied by LL or member of his family as was let on.
these laws i spoke of where in place a lot longer …we looked in to it back around 2006 and non evicting co-op conversions were already exempt from the sponsor or owner taking an apartment as well as it had to be in personal name as corporations and LLCS can’t have family

if you really wanted to dabble in stabilized co-op apartments you need a broker who is involved in getting the listings and not just an ad on line as the good stuff goes out to the pros who are known players .
there are brokers who are the go to brokers that sponsors utilize to sell off apartments …they then have a calling list of players so the real deals never are in an advertisement…no reason to .
the investors who took our remaining two already owned 3 or 4 in the building so there are ways of searching a building for investors if you are a broker and calling them .
one phone call and we were in negotiations.
so playing this market really is a good ole boys club that is closed to most amateurs .
it is usually big investor groups or corporations that play in this area since corporations have an infinite life time to wait for an opportunity to cash in
